WebMar 15, 2024 · Magnetic Disk: A magnetic disk is a storage device that uses a magnetization process to write, rewrite and access data. It is covered with a magnetic coating and stores data in the form of tracks, spots and sectors. Hard disks, zip disks and floppy disks are common examples of magnetic disks. WebMagnetic storage is the manipulation of magnetic fields on a medium in order to record audio, video or other data.
